What Is a 690V 125A BS88 Style High Speed Fuse?

A 690V 125A BS88 Style High Speed Fuse is a specially engineered current-limiting fuse designed to protect semiconductor devices and power electronic systems from damaging overcurrent and short-circuit conditions.

Unlike conventional fuses, high speed fuses react extremely quickly when fault currents occur, minimizing thermal and mechanical stress on sensitive components.

The BS88 style design follows internationally recognized dimensions and performance standards, making replacement and system integration easier across industrial applications.


How Does a High Speed Fuse Work?

High speed fuses operate by rapidly melting their fuse element when excessive current flows through the circuit.

The specially designed fuse element creates multiple arc points during interruption. These arcs are quickly extinguished using high-purity silica sand filling, allowing the fuse to safely interrupt fault currents before they can damage connected equipment.

The protection process typically occurs within milliseconds, significantly faster than many traditional protection devices.

Why Fast Protection Matters

Modern electrical systems increasingly rely on semiconductor components such as IGBTs, MOSFETs, SCRs, and power modules. These components can be damaged within milliseconds during a fault event.

Without adequate protection, a short circuit may lead to:

  • Permanent semiconductor failure
  • Costly equipment downtime
  • Production interruptions
  • Fire hazards
  • Expensive maintenance costs
  • Reduced system reliability

A properly selected high speed fuse significantly reduces these risks by clearing fault currents before critical components reach destructive energy levels.

How to Choose the Right High Speed Fuse

Selecting the correct fuse requires evaluating several important factors:

  1. System operating voltage
  2. Continuous current requirements
  3. Expected fault current levels
  4. Semiconductor withstand capability
  5. Ambient operating temperature
  6. Installation dimensions
  7. Applicable industry standards
  8. Coordination with other protection devices

A comprehensive protection study helps ensure optimal fuse performance and system reliability.


Common Causes of Fuse Operation

When a high speed fuse operates, it often indicates an underlying issue that should be investigated.

  • Short circuit conditions
  • Semiconductor device failure
  • Incorrect component sizing
  • Insulation breakdown
  • Power supply abnormalities
  • Wiring faults
  • Overload conditions
  • Environmental contamination

Proper root-cause analysis helps prevent repeated fuse replacements and future system failures.
